Energy Efficiency Upgrades to Complement Home Renewable Energy Systems

Are you interested in reducing your carbon footprint and lowering your energy bills? Investing in renewable energy
systems for your home, such as solar panels or wind turbines, is a great way to achieve this goal. However, to
maximize the benefits of these systems, it’s essential to also focus on energy efficiency upgrades. By making
your home more energy-efficient, you can further reduce your environmental impact and enhance the performance
of your renewable energy systems. Let’s explore some energy efficiency upgrades that can complement your home
renewable energy systems.

1. Insulation and Sealing

Proper insulation and sealing are the foundation of an energy-efficient home. Insulating your walls, roof, and
floors helps maintain a consistent indoor temperature, reducing the need for excessive heating or cooling.
Additionally, sealing any gaps, cracks, or leaks in your home’s structure prevents energy loss. This means your
renewable energy systems won’t have to work as hard to compensate for heat or cold air escaping the house.

2. Energy-Efficient Appliances

Upgrading to energy-efficient appliances is a simple yet effective way to save energy and money. Look for
appliances with the ENERGY STAR label, which indicates they meet strict energy efficiency guidelines. Energy
Star-rated refrigerators, washing machines, dishwashers, and other household appliances consume significantly
less energy compared to their conventional counterparts, without sacrificing performance.

3. LED Lighting

Replace traditional incandescent light bulbs with energy-efficient LED bulbs. LED bulbs use up to 80% less energy
and last much longer. They also produce less heat, reducing the strain on your home cooling system. With a wide
range of color temperatures and styles available, you can create a cozy and inviting atmosphere while saving
energy.

4. Smart Thermostats

Smart thermostats offer precise control over your home’s temperature, allowing you to optimize energy usage. By
learning your behavior and preferences, these devices can automatically adjust the temperature when you’re away
or asleep, ensuring no energy goes to waste. Some smart thermostats even provide detailed energy consumption
reports, helping you identify areas for improvement.

5. Energy-Efficient Windows

Replacing old, inefficient windows with energy-efficient ones can significantly improve your home’s insulation.
Look for windows with low-emissivity (low-E) glass, which reflects heat back into the room during winter and
blocks heat from entering during summer. Additionally, double or triple-pane windows with insulating gas between
the layers provide superior thermal performance.

6. Energy Monitoring Systems

Implementing an energy monitoring system allows you to track your energy consumption in real-time. By identifying
energy-intensive activities or appliances, you can make informed decisions about reducing your usage. Some
monitoring systems also provide recommendations for energy-saving practices, helping you maximize the benefits
of your renewable energy systems.

7. Proper Maintenance

Maintaining your renewable energy systems and conducting regular inspections is crucial for their optimal
performance. Clean solar panels regularly to remove any dirt or debris that may obstruct sunlight. Similarly,
ensure wind turbines are well-lubricated and free from damage. By keeping your systems in top condition, you can
ensure they operate efficiently and produce maximum energy.
